Why Are Eye Exams Important?
Eye exams do more than just determine your prescription; they are also crucial for detecting and managing eye diseases. Eye diseases often develop without any symptoms over long periods. Neglecting regular eye exams can lead to undiagnosed eye disease, which, in turn, can cause vision loss or even blindness.
As you grow older, your risk of developing eye diseases like glaucoma and AMD rises, and conditions like cataracts may start to affect the quality of your vision.
Yearly eye exams are recommended.
What Can I Expect from an Eye Exam?
When you come in for your eye exam, your optometrist will start the appointment off with a short conversation about your medical history as well as your family history. Some eye problems like myopia and glaucoma can have a hereditary component, so having this information allows your optometrist to tailor the exam to address your needs better.
During this conversation, please bring up any questions or concerns you may have about your eye health. We love it when our patients are involved with their eye exams because it helps us provide the best care possible.
Following this conversation, we start testing your eye’s strength, acuity, and coordination. Some of these tests you might recognize even if you’ve never been to an eye exam, including reading an eye chart, checking your visual strength through a phoropter, and checking your coordination using an ocular motility test.
Following these tests and looking for signs of eye disease, we will help you choose new glasses or contact lenses if you need them. You will meet our trained opticians who will help you find a beautiful pair of frames to match your look and lifestyle.
